Reading's Victorian and Edwardian terraces along the Thames Valley, combined with the town's high water table and clay-rich soils, create ideal conditions for rising and penetrating damp. Whether you're in the period properties of Caversham, the Victorian streets around the town centre, or the inter-war semis spreading towards Earley and Tilehurst, damp problems affect thousands of Reading households annually. A qualified damp proof specialist in Reading understands the specific challenges these older properties face—and the damage that untreated damp causes to structural integrity, decoration, and health. From chemical injection systems to membrane installation and timber decay treatment, effective damp control requires local knowledge of Reading's building stock and climate patterns.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a damp proof specialist cost in Reading?
Survey costs typically £150–£300 depending on property size and complexity. Remedial treatments range from £1,500 for chemical injection to £5,000+ for structural waterproofing. Request quotes from local specialists for accurate pricing.
Is my damp problem rising damp or penetrating damp?
Rising damp appears as damp patches at floor level, often with salt staining. Penetrating damp shows where external moisture enters walls, especially near ground. A professional survey with a damp meter will confirm which type affects your property.
How quickly can I get a damp specialist to survey my Reading home?
Most Reading-based specialists offer surveys within 5–10 working days. Emergency call-outs for severe leaks or structural concerns may be faster. Contact local firms directly for availability and appointment times.
Can damp proof treatments be applied in winter in Reading?
Chemical injection and membrane systems work year-round, but heavy rain and frost can delay drying. Many specialists recommend autumn or spring for optimal results, though urgent cases can be treated whenever necessary.
